The main variable of ground synchronous observation is surface temperature. This data can provide a basic data set for surface temperature inversion and verification of airborne satellite remote sensing data. The measurement contents are as follows: the hand-held infrared thermometer is used to measure the surface temperature in sample a (reed land), sample B (saline alkali land), sample C (saline alkali land), sample D (alfalfa land) and sample e (barley land) in the intensive observation area of Linze grassland. Synchronous quadrat includes 120m × 120m quadrat and 30m × There are two kinds of 30m encrypted small quadrats. During the measurement, continuous measurement shall be carried out along the northeast direction. This data set includes the excel table of surface temperature measurement data of 5 quadrats.
